Jay Morrish (c. 1936 – March 2, 2015) was an American golf course designer. He graduated from Colorado State University with a degree in Landscape and Nursery Management. In 1964, he taught Horticulture at that university while pursuing graduate degrees.

Frequently asked about Jay Morrish

What is the hardest Jay Morrish course?

Castle Hills in Lewisville, TX is the hardest Jay Morrish course in the Stymie directory with a maximum slope rating of 152. Slope rating measures difficulty for a bogey golfer relative to a scratch player — 113 is average, 140+ is very difficult.

What is the longest Jay Morrish course?

Castle Hills in Lewisville, TX is the longest Jay Morrish course at 7,320 yards from the back tees.

What is the easiest Jay Morrish course to play?

Among public and municipal Jay Morrish courses, River Valley Ranch Golf Club in Carbondale, CO has the lowest slope rating at 99. Courses with a slope under 115 are typically considered beginner-friendly.

How many Jay Morrish courses have a slope of 140 or higher?

12 Jay Morrish courses in the Stymie directory carry a max slope rating of 140 or higher, out of 20 with published scorecard data.

How long is the average Jay Morrish course?

Across 20 Jay Morrish courses with published scorecards, the average maximum yardage from the back tees is 6,690 yards. The longest plays to 7,320 yards.
